Follow each sub-list down so everything is covered Deployment Components ===================== Let's consider the components in each layer of our system. Network Level ------------- NSG Rules ^^^^^^^^^ - what rules do you expect? - SSH (22) - HTTP (80) - HTTPS (443) Service Level ------------- KeyVault ^^^^^^^^ - a secret: database connection string - an access policy for our VM AADB2C ^^^^^^ - tenant directory - linked to a subscription - protected API (user_impersonation scope) - Postman client application - SUSI flow Hosting Environment Level ------------------------- VM External Configuration 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 - size - status - image (defines available tools) - system assigned identity for KV access VM internal configuration 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 - runtime dependencies - dotnet - mysql - nginx - self-signed SSL cert - what running services are needed? - embedded MySQL database server - NGINX web server (reverse proxy) - Coding Events API service - MySQL service configuration - user and database for the API - NGINX service configuration - RP configuration - using SSL cert - Coding Events API service configuration - unit file - published artifact in service directory Application Level ----------------- - appsettings.json (external configuration) - source code - could have issues but we will assume it is working as expected
